The 2n2222a transistor can be replace by any other 2n2222 transistor and it should not affect the functioning of the circuit even if its. High current transistor switch for dc motor control circuit. With bipolare transistors you must perhaps use darlington transistors as well. The open drain transistor reset pin 7 can sink 100ma to 1v. The relay contact is rated for mains voltage, so no problem. I have not yet connected it to my 24vac sources as i wanted to test the circuit before hand, my assumption is i should still hear the click of the relay. As shown in the diagram, the section basically consists of a transistor t1, resistor r1 and a flyback diode d1 connected across the relay coil. Here is a bit of a description that can be used as a guide in designing tips or relay drivers using bipolar transistors. If you want to take 12v output from the 555, assuming the 555 can drive whatever hes driving and the transistor base current at the same time, you must take into account the baseemitter voltage drop of the transistor read kirchoff laws, so you. How to make 12v relay driver circuit using transistor proteus simulation. It uses an nmosfet to power the lamp, eliminating the relay i used an lm317 regulator to provide the 12v for the timer. If you want to know how to design and configure a relay driver stage using a transistor, you can read it in the following post.
I mostly understand how it works, but i would like to. They had a flaw of having to be electrically connected to low voltage digital circuits. Optoisolated transistor drivers microcontroller interfacing. But sometimes it is required to switch larger relay coils or currents beyond the range of a bc109 general purpose transistor and this can be achieved using darlington transistors. When the circuit is powered, the 555 timer ic should provide a pulse with a predefined on time and off time. A relay driver circuit is a circuit which can drive, or operate, a relay so that it can function appropriately in a circuit. Here is another example of bipolar junction transistor bjt switching. Pic 16f54 needs to drive a 5v relay i am using a pic 16f54 and need to trigger a 5v relay. Driving relays with cmos and ttl outputs calculator. In this case we will study a high voltage switching circuit i. I will be using an npn transistor in my proteus simulation. This problem is severe if the input circuit is a lighttemperature sensor.
Relay h bridge driver circuit, simulation, and arduino programming. Electronics tutorial about the relay switch circuit and relay switching circuits. This circuit is called a relay driver circuit, which is highlighted in the circuit diagram above. If you only need the circuit diagram and programming then you can jump to the circuit diagram and programming section, but trust me this will never help you learn the designing.
With optoisolators we can sever this connection including the use of highervoltage power supplies totally isolated from the lowvoltage digital circuits. Q1 is not a constant current source your current will vary with input voltage. In the circuit diagram, our load is a motor inductive load. Relay h bridge driver circuit, simulation, and arduino.
The control signal may be obtained by manual input or may be generated by another. This video npn transistor based 12v dc relay control drive simple make it, this type transistor is a semiconductor device used to switch electronic. An electronic circuit will normally need a relay driver using a transistor circuit stage in order to converter its low power dc switching output into a high power mains ac switching output. You also need an emitter resistor to define the constant. As shown in the following circuit diagram, the relay driver may consist a npn transistor or a pnp transistor. Zxld20 ev3 with an external mosfet switch driving 1 led at 2800ma from 6. The coil of the relay needs a large current around 150ma to drive the relay, which an arduino cannot provide. Is there a decent free circuit simulator that has relays and runs in real time. Here is the list of best free circuit simulation software for windows. When the base voltage of the transistor is zero or negative, the transistor is cutoff and acts as an open switch. So lets go through different step to design a better relay driving circuit. The tlc555 output pin 3 can sink a 100ma load to 1. Practical circuit relay driver using bipolar transistor. In the second section, you must choose a transistor, which.
The relay driver circuit using uln2003 is given below. This is because the classic single transistor source produces a constant current in the collector circuit not the emitter using a constant baseemitter voltage. A relay driver circuit or simply relay circuit is an electromagnetic switch that will be used whenever we want to use a low voltage circuit to switch a light bulb on and off which is connected to. Drive a singlecoil latching relay without an hbridge circuit. Ensure the transistor can handle the voltage and current required by the load. This calculator will help find a suitable switching transistor, and provide a value for the base resistor that will sufficiently saturate the transistor. Acdc led drivers 53 dcdc led drivers 39 linear led drivers 55 motor drivers. As the back emf will be in the opposite polarity to the normal voltage across the coil, the diode. So, my guess is the relay needs a current of 563 79ma. Public circuits, schematics, and circuit simulations on circuitlab tagged transistor. When the applet starts up you will see an animated schematic of a simple lrc circuit. Obviously, ensure that the transistors are only turned on for a short amount of time, as they will sink reasonable current. Circuitlab is an inbrowser schematic capture and circuit simulation software tool to help you rapidly. Changing the input voltage causes changes in the base current, collector.
The following simulation shows how a typical relay may be wired with a dc voltage source across its coils and a mains ac load across its no and nc contacts. It is similar to others i have seen, though it appears to have two extra parts that others do not have. A transistor works best as a switch when it is connected with a common emitter configuration, meaning the emitter of the bjt must be always connected directly with ground line. In this circuit diagram, the pic microcontroller is providing a signal to 4 relays through relay driver ic uln2003. A driver circuit simply consists of an npn or pnp type transistor and a resistor. The diodes circuit simulator is a free downloadable simulator which allows. For my transistor circuit, im pulling from the vin pin on the arduinio, which is also 12v. In this project the npn transistor 2n2222 drives the relay when the npn junction gets saturated. To do this, im powering the arduino with 12 volts via the power port on the arduino. Make circuit by using a relay in the dcaclab simulator. Did you find that this computer simulation was helpful in any way in furthering. Today bjt switches are common in many electronic circuits and control systems.
The driven relay can then operate as a switch in the circuit which can open or close, according to the needs of the circuit and its operation. Dont use the single pnp circuit to switch voltages greater than the microcontroller supply voltage. If desired, the relay can be powered by a separate power supply, so, for instance, 12v solenoids can be controlled by the microcontroller. Simple transistor relay circuit transistor as a switch youtube.
Transistor relay driver circuit with formula and calculations. How to make 12v relay driver circuit using transistor proteus. One of the serious problems in relay operated circuits is the relay clicking or chattering during the onoff of the relay driver transistor. Basically when the circuit is powered on, first press in pushbutton switch make the relay set, then the second press will make the relay reset state. It is in three sections, and the first section will find the correct transistor providing you with ideal values for the hfe and collector current parameters of a suitable transistor.
A transistor switch is used to allow a 12 volt relay to be operated turned on and off by. How to connect a relay through an optocoupler homemade. Transistor switch driving a relay terpconnect university of maryland. The relay circuit considerations can be split into two main areas.
This video will describe how to build a relay driver circuit that can be used with a digital circuit or a microcontroller. One pulse to onoff bistable latching relay electrical. I cannot figure out how to make it so that flipping an io pin from 0v to 5v switches the transistor, this allowing 12v to go across the relay. Drive relay by digital circuit circuit wiring diagrams. In this project, we will build a relay driver for both dc and ac relays. When uses as an amplifier the dc current gain of the transistor can be calculated by using the below formulae.
Tying both lines together is permissible because they are logically the same polarity and this potentially doubles the sink current ability to 200ma. Practical circuit relay driver using bipolar transistor how to design a practical relay driver circuit using bipolar transistor. By has various resistorr limit proper current for circuit. Once made on proteus, you can make some connections for hardware i am not responsible f. Figure 1 shows a simple circuit using the mc9s08qe128 microcontroller from freescale to drive a finder 40. Heres a typical circuit for driving a latching relay.
Relay is a component consisting of an iron core coil which will produce an electromagnet when. Transistor switch driving a relay download for macintosh or for pc a transistor switch is used to allow a 12 volt relay to be operated turned on and off by a small input voltage, e in the voltage level of the input can be changed by sliding the black arrow head up and down on this vertical scale. These freeware let you design as well as simulate circuits on your pc. To suppress this back emf a diode is typically placed across the coil.
As we know, the threshold voltage required at the base terminal of an npn transistor is 0. Below is the ltspice simulation of a representative circuit using a 555 astable multivibrator. Depends on the designer whether heshe wants to use the pnp or npn. Now a question arises, why do we need the extra bit of circuit to drive the relay. How to wire a relay to a transistor explained through. The previous npn transistor relay switch circuit is ideal for switching small loads such as leds and miniature relays. In this project we control direction and speed of a 24v high current motor using arduino and two relays. In part 1 we looked at a number of bipolar transistor and mosfet driver circuits. Part b is a simple transistor switching onoff circuit. Npn transistor based dc relay drive make triggering. Here the ground refers to the negative line for an npn and the positive line for a pnp bjt. In figure 3 is the driver relay circuit by use input voltage to feed to the relay coil, but has some voltage junction base and emitter lead of transistor.
In order to drive a relay, voltage needs to be applied to the coil. Ive been trying to design a latching relay driver circuit, with using a pushbutton switch. Circuit design of 12v relay driver using transistor as a switch. Diode d1 and capacitor c3 form a bootstrap circuit to provide power to the timer when the lamp is on. A typical relay switch circuit has the coil driven by a npn transistor switch, tr1 as shown depending on the input voltage level. Im trying to design a control circuit but i cant find any programs that have all three of my needs. The switch part is used to control high power circuits. The ncv7240 is an automotive eight channel low side driver providing drive capability up to 600 ma per channel. The purpose of this tutorial is to learn the use of relay on proteus. The circuit above produces a strong pulse to latch the relay on and the input voltage must remain high. As we know bc547 transistor switched on when its base to emitter voltage. If its a pnp transistor, the base is coupled at the collector of the photo transistor, alternatively, if a npn transistor is used in the relay driver, the trigger is received from the emitter of the photo transistor. Relay a relay can be used to switch higher power devices such as motors and solenoids. For the driver circuit to design, first of all, we find the relay coil resistance using a digital.
Output control is via a spi port and offers convenient reporting of faults for open load or short to ground, over load, and over temperature conditions. Using these software, you can actually checkout how a circuit will behave, and also know additional information including its waveform. You can also consider working temperature range for your circuit. Above the cut in voltage, the transistor turns on current flow from collector to emitter. This pulse will then be used to turn onoff the relay through a transistor. The most diode will be diode that is in the general rectifier circuit is 1n4001 etc. Is there a decent free circuit simulator that has relays. Protect the transistor with a snubbing diode if the load is a relay, solenoid, motor or otherwise inductive.
To power a relay or configure it with an electronic circuit, a small output circuit is generally incorporated and is known as the relay driver circuit. Simple common emitter transistor relay drive circuit. Transistor circuits in proteus as switch,bistable,astable,inverter. Dc current gain collector current ic base current ib applications. One push button will rotate motor clockwise and other will rotate it counter clockwise. Relay h bridge driver circuit, simulation, and arduino programming in this tutorial, you will learn how to design and make your own relay h bridge to control a dc motor. No power switches are needed for this circuit, just two push buttons and in potentiometer to control the direction and speed of dc motor. This page covers just about all the options for driving a relay with transistors. Online schematic capture lets hobbyists easily share and discuss their designs, while online circuit simulation allows for quick design iteration and. All the relay driver circuits above are the pulse output of the digital circuit to control a transistor works and drive relay as an onoff switch for circuit or external devices next, to using it now selected to suit the. Relay driver circuit using uln2003 and its applications. During the transition of lighttemperature levels, the relay clicks which may cause sparking of contacts.
Ive searched online and find this normal relay driving solution. In one of the previous article we had already discussed about how transistor acts as switch. A high current, high voltage relay needs a power transistor to driving it. Design a sustainable relay driving circuit using bjt. In addition, you must design a demagnetization circuit using a special resistor to limit the current in compliance with the manufacturers specifications. This tutorial will guide to to make simple circuit using npn transistor as.
235 831 280 1493 538 1125 784 1151 944 322 1414 1330 648 1050 1155 1414 1013 170 16 1276 403 421 28 1224 1310 1454 902 703 978 542 817 574 200 277 277